On Sunday 25 April 2004 12:54, David Hampton wrote:
> I saw Axel's recent message about new kernels being available, but
> apt-get on my system doesn't see them.  My system was built about a
> month ago using Jarod's guide, and I haven't seen any other issues with
> apt-get.  Anyone have an idea of what I might be doing wrong?  I've
> attached my sources.list file below.  AFICT, its the same as the latest
> one from Axel except the kde-redhat.org lines are commented out. Thanks.

Try an apt-get update before trying to apt-get the new kernel. Your local 
package listings may be out of date (I've installed the new kernel on a 
number of machines now, so I know its there ;-).
